Python图形界面库notcurses-1.5.1版本发布
版权申诉
64 浏览量
更新于2024-10-13
收藏 10KB GZ 举报
资源摘要信息: "Python库 | notcurses-1.5.1.tar.gz"
本文档提供的资源是一份Python库文件,具体为notcurses-1.5.1版本的压缩包文件。在深入探讨该资源之前,需要对几个关键点进行阐述。
首先,"Python库"指的是用Python语言编写的软件包,这些包可以提供各种功能,使得开发者能够利用这些现成的代码来增强或简化自己的项目开发过程。Python库具有高度的模块化特点,使得在项目中引入特定功能变得非常便捷。
描述中提到的"notcurses"是一个具体的Python库,其功能主要是在终端中进行丰富的文本和颜色输出,提供了一种较为高级的字符界面绘图能力。该库允许用户创建复杂的用户界面,包括但不限于颜色、窗口、面板、滚动条等,而不仅仅局限于传统的命令行界面。这在进行系统管理、监控或需要在命令行环境下提供丰富交互的应用时尤其有用。
notcurses库的特点还包括其性能优化,能够有效减少终端闪烁,提供流畅的视觉体验。它支持多种终端类型,并且拥有良好的跨平台能力,能够在Linux、BSD和macOS等类Unix系统上运行。
根据描述,notcurses库的当前版本为1.5.1,这是一个稳定版本,意味着它已经经过测试和验证,能够在大多数场景中可靠地工作。用户可以根据自己的需要,通过官方提供的资源安装此库。
标签"python 开发语言 Python库"表明该资源专为Python语言开发,且是一个Python库。"Python库"这个词在标签中重复出现,可能是因为其在标签系统中起到分类的作用,强调该资源是Python开发中的一个重要组成部分。
压缩包子文件的文件名称列表仅包含"notcurses-1.5.1"一项,这意味着该资源只有一个文件。通常情况下,一个压缩包文件包含了所有必要的库文件和相关文档,安装后即可在Python环境中使用。
关于安装方法,描述中提供了安装步骤的链接,这表明用户需要遵循一定的步骤才能在本地环境中安装notcurses库。通常,这样的步骤包括下载压缩包文件,解压文件,以及使用Python的包管理工具pip进行安装。安装完成后,开发者可以在Python脚本中使用import语句导入notcurses模块,进而调用其提供的丰富接口来实现复杂的文本界面功能。
开发者在使用该库时,应当注意该库可能依赖于其他库或特定的系统组件,因此在安装之前需要确认环境是否满足所有依赖要求。此外,开发者还应当留意notcurses库的更新和维护情况,因为库的后续版本可能会引入新的特性和改进,同时也可能包含对旧版本的不兼容更改。
总之,notcurses库是一个强大的工具,它扩展了Python在命令行界面开发方面的能力。通过提供高级的绘图和用户界面功能,它使得创建复杂且美观的命令行应用程序变得更加容易。开发者在掌握了该库的使用后,可以在其项目中实现高效的命令行界面,从而提升用户体验和应用程序的可用性。
2017-01-08 上传
2024-08-21 上传
2022-05-21 上传
2022-04-12 上传
2022-04-09 上传
2022-04-10 上传
2022-05-11 上传
2022-04-12 上传
2022-03-04 上传
挣扎的蓝藻
- 粉丝: 14w+
- 资源: 15万+
最新资源
- Java集合ArrayList实现字符串管理及效果展示
- 实现2D3D相机拾取射线的关键技术
- LiveLy-公寓管理门户:创新体验与技术实现
- 易语言打造的快捷禁止程序运行小工具
- Microgateway核心:实现配置和插件的主端口转发
- 掌握Java基本操作:增删查改入门代码详解
- Apache Tomcat 7.0.109 Windows版下载指南
- Qt实现文件系统浏览器界面设计与功能开发
- ReactJS新手实验:搭建与运行教程
- 探索生成艺术:几个月创意Processing实验
- Django框架下Cisco IOx平台实战开发案例源码解析
- 在Linux环境下配置Java版VTK开发环境
- 29街网上城市公司网站系统v1.0:企业建站全面解决方案
- WordPress CMB2插件的Suggest字段类型使用教程
- TCP协议实现的Java桌面聊天客户端应用
- ANR-WatchDog: 检测Android应用无响应并报告异常